Welcome to the first in our new series called 'One To Watch'. This month we look at the talented singer Amie Aitken.

With some fabulous shoes to wear and many professional plates to spin, there is so much more to Amie Aitken than just music...

Having started out just over a year ago, Amie has catapulted her music career off to a strong start. After completing one small acoustic tour around Scotland, she gathered together a small but loyal fanbase who helped her to fund the recording of her debut EP "Audience Of One" - produced by Sound Consultancy

This year she has supported artists from the USA and UK including Ian White and one of the UK's brightest talents, Philippa Hanna. With a commendable combination of artistic creativity, diligent organisation and unwavering determination Amie has built up a loyal network of supporters who have helped her to release her new music for all to enjoy. Influenced by artists such as Jimmy Needham, Sara Bareilles and Emeli Sande, Amie brings together a blend of catchy pop-soul melodies and intentionally thought-provoking, relatable lyrics.


Sharing her faith is a vital part of Amie’s musical endeavors Her passion for encouraging and inspiring a younger generation belies the heart of every performance. Having spent some time in foster care herself and having several years of experience of working with vulnerable children, her mission now is to ensure that each individual knows their worth and potential. Amie partnered with Home For Good to help her take this message across the country on her 2014 tour, following the EP release last November.

Amie says "When I imagine how different my life would be if I were still in foster care, I'm so grateful for the opportunities and the life I've been given. There are so many children in the UK who still need a home for good and I believe the Church needs to be part of the solution."

Amie balances her music ministry with her new role as Children & Families worker in a local Scottish church and finds time for tea and cake with friends whenever she can.
